Quick note for visiting contractors: as of next Monday, the reception desk at Quarrelane Point moves from level two down to the ground floor, just inside the main doors. Don't bother heading upstairs — you'll only find the plants. Sign in at the new desk, grab a lanyard, and someone from the Pellworth team will collect you. If you arrive before 08:00, the side entrance is your friend, and it takes the door code below.

badge for haduf-bafop: bdg-O-78

Step 4 — Slimming the Kelverin worker image

Switch the base image to the minimal runtime variant and remove the build toolchain from the final stage. Verify the resulting image stays under 180 MB, as the pipeline rejects anything larger. Keep the healthcheck binary; several probes depend on it. Before rebuilding, set the image build parameters exactly as follows.

deployment values, yadug-bawif:
[framir]
team = pelox
access_code = ac_a38ab2
owner = tamion.julael
host = framir.tolvaqlabs.test
port = 11211
peer = tammir.zemvargrid.local
salt = 2215ef03
pin = 1541

**Ticket #—: Flaky integration tests in Coinlark payments**

Plugin authors: if your integration tests against the Coinlark sandbox keep dropping connections, it's not your code — the shared test database hits its connection cap around the top of each hour. Workaround for now: retry with backoff, or point your suite at the dedicated plugin-test database using the connection below.

warehouse DSN: mssql://rusdor_svc:0FSWCn9@db-951a.paliqforge.local:5432/ulawyn

Ticket: SquatSift vault locked after failed unseal attempts

The credentials vault for SquatSift, our typo-squatting package scanner, locked itself after three bad unseal attempts during Tuesday's deploy. New team members: this is expected behavior, not an outage. Scanner jobs queue safely until the vault reopens. To restore access, run the unseal script from the ops bastion and enter the recovery passphrase when prompted. The current passphrase is below.

unlock words, hahip-baduf: holwyn-istath-julvan